Getting Married in Ibiza? Here’s How to Keep Your Hair & Makeup Fresh All Day

Ibiza weddings are unforgettable — golden sunsets, salty air, and celebrations that last from morning prep to midnight parties. But with the island’s heat and humidity, keeping your bridal hair and makeup looking fresh all day can feel like a challenge. The good news? With the right prep, products, and expertise, you can stay glowing from “I do” to the last dance.

1. Start with Good Skin Prep

Great makeup always starts with great skin. In the Ibiza heat, less is more. I always recommend:

  • Hydration: Drink plenty of water in the lead-up to your wedding day. Dehydrated skin won’t hold makeup well.

  • Light moisturiser: Avoid heavy creams that sit on the surface — go for a lightweight, hydrating base.

  • SPF — always: Ibiza’s sun is strong, and SPF helps keep your skin protected without interfering with makeup.

Before we start, I’ll prep your skin with products designed for warm climates, ensuring everything layers beautifully and stays comfortable all day.

2. Choose Products That Withstand the Heat

Ibiza weddings mean hours outdoors — between photos, dinners, and dancing, your makeup has to perform. I use lightweight, breathable products with serious staying power, from waterproof mascara to humidity-resistant foundations.

The goal isn’t to wear more; it’s to use smarter products that melt into the skin rather than sitting on top of it. This keeps you glowing — never greasy.

3. Focus on Long-Lasting Hair Techniques

Humidity, wind, and dancing can all test your hairstyle. I use techniques and products designed specifically for Mediterranean weather, from anti-humidity sprays to flexible holds that keep movement in your style without losing shape.

Up-dos, polished ponytails, or softly structured waves all work beautifully here — elegant, photo-ready, and long-lasting.

4. Touch-Ups Make All the Difference

I always plan a post-ceremony retouch so you can refresh before photos and dinner. It only takes ten minutes — a quick revival of your glow, a fresh lip, and a light hair check to make sure everything’s still perfect.
